Julia Brannon Wason Dahl

Julia Brannon Wason Dahl
(Mrs. Otto J. Dahl)

The following newspaper article, hand-dated Dec. 31, 1954, was found in a scrapbook owned by Town Historian Richard Schmal:

    KEEP GOLDEN WEDDING DAY

    Mr. and Mrs. Otto J. Dahl celebrated their 50th wedding anniversary with an open house at their Lake Prairie home Sunday afternoon and evening.

    With them were their six daughters and their families. Mr. and Mrs. Thomas E. Fairchild and children of Milwaukee, Wisconsin; Mr. and Mrs. Joseph Weinberg, Lowell; Mr. and Mrs. Edmund G. Klemm and children of Waukesha, Wisconsin; Mr. and Mrs. George Wemple, Crown Point; Mrs. Henry C. Kirk and sons, Burlington, Iowa; Mr. and Mrs. John Sybolsky and son, Yonkers, New York.

    Many friends and relatives stopped in to wish the Golden Wedding bridegroom and his bride well. Dr. Isobel Wason of Washington, D.C., Miss Edith L. Burhans of Hammond, and Mrs. Arthur Hoffman of Joliet, Illinois, who were present at the wedding 50 years ago, returned to spend the day with them.

    Mr. and Mrs. Dahl were married at the home of her father T. Abbot Wason, December 28, 1904.
